CIDE DICTIONARY

light-headeda. 
  •  Disordered in the head; dizzy; feeling faint; delirious.  Walpole.  [1913 Webster]
  •  Thoughtless; heedless; volatile; unsteady; fickle; loose; lacking seriousness; given to frivolity; as, light-headed teenagers.  Clarendon.  [1913 Webster]
